Understanding HDMI Cable Types: Which One Do You Need?

Choosing the right HDMI cord can feel tricky, but knowing the different types is simpler than you imagine. Initially, there were basic HDMI cables , then came HDMI 1.4, which added support for functionalities like 3D and audio return channel (ARC). Now, HDMI 2.0 and 2.1 are common , offering higher bandwidth for Ultra HD resolution, faster refresh rates, and improved features like Dynamic HDR. Generally, for older devices, a original HDMI wire is sufficient , but for modern equipment , especially those enabling 4K or 8K, an HDMI 2.1 wire is advised to provide optimal performance. Don't just check the version number; in addition pay heed to the defined features and mentioned capabilities.

Unlock Faster Transfers: A Deep Dive into USB 3.1 Data Cables

USB 3.1 lines provide a significant improvement in record transmission velocities compared to previous standards. These current wires leverage a distinct architecture allowing for up to 10 Gbps per instance, around ten times the rate of USB 2.0. Understanding the several kinds of USB 3.1 adapters, such as Type-A, Type-C, and Micro-B, and ensuring you apply compatible devices is crucial for obtaining these impressive functioning stages.
